Foreman was actually already 230 pounds at age 19(all muscles too, heavier than Lewis-Wlad-Vitali-Bowe at 19) but was told to lose the weight because they wanted a lighter version as was typical for 70s boxers. Foreman never really benefited from being that light.
With his natural large frame if you think a young Foreman with all the modern sports training would only weigh in at 225 lbs today is silly.
He'd probably be in the 235-245 range trim at 6'3.5".

Interesting fight.
Wilders pluses - great power, good jab when he uses it, good overall speed
Wilder minuses - very little boxing skills, questionable stamina, average chin at best, average defense at best
Foreman pluses - great power, great resilience, great chin
Foreman minuses - really slow hand and foot speed, average defense at best,
